Functional Benefits of Gravel Over Turf
Gravel offers practical advantages: it drains quickly, resists weeds, and reduces long-term maintenance. Strategic gravel placement around plant beds, walkways, and entryways improves accessibility and prevents soil erosion, making it an ideal choice for busy homeowners and eco-conscious design lovers alike.
Design Tips for Cohesive Front Yard Appeal
To achieve a polished look, select gravel with uniform particle size and cohesive color. Layer gravel under trees, along pathways, and near stepping stones for structure. Pair with native plants or drought-tolerant ground cover to soften edges and add seasonal interest while maintaining a clean, professional finish.
